Choosing the Right Shower Drain
Selecting the right type of shower drain is the first step toward a successful installation. Common types include:
Center drains: Located in the middle of the shower floor, ideal for standard rectangular or square showers.
Linear drains: Long, narrow drains positioned along one side, suitable for modern, curbless designs.
Point drains: Small, centralized drains often paired with pre-formed shower pans.
Material selection is equally important. Stainless steel, brass, and high-quality PVC are durable choices that resist corrosion and wear. Ensure the drain size matches local plumbing codes and is compatible with your shower’s water flow rate.
Preparing the Installation Area
Proper preparation is crucial for preventing future issues. Start by ensuring the subfloor is clean, level, and free of debris. Any uneven surfaces can compromise the drain’s alignment and lead to pooling water. If you’re installing a tile shower, check that the mortar bed allows for the correct slope toward the drain—ideally, a gradient of about 1/4 inch per foot to encourage efficient drainage.
Next, examine the plumbing system. Ensure the drainpipe is the correct diameter, typically 2 inches for residential showers, and confirm that the slope of the pipe itself supports gravity flow toward the main waste line. Even a slight misalignment can reduce water flow, creating the perfect environment for clogs and odors.
Step-by-Step Drain Installation Tips
Secure the Drain Assembly: Begin by attaching the drain body to the shower floor according to manufacturer instructions. Apply plumber’s putty or silicone sealant around the drain flange to create a watertight seal. Be careful not to overapply, as excess material can interfere with drainage.
Check Alignment: Ensure the drain is perfectly level with the shower floor. Use a spirit level to confirm accuracy. A misaligned drain will cause water to pool in low spots, increasing the risk of mold growth and slippery surfaces.
Connect to the Plumbing: Attach the drain tailpiece to the waste pipe securely. If using PVC, ensure proper solvent welding to avoid leaks. For metal pipes, threaded connections should be tight but not overtightened to prevent cracking or stripping.
Test for Leaks: Before proceeding with the shower base or tile installation, pour water into the drain and inspect all connections. Catching leaks at this stage prevents costly repairs later.
Install the Shower Floor: Whether it’s a pre-fabricated pan or a tiled surface, make sure the floor slopes consistently toward the drain. For tiled floors, apply a waterproofing membrane or liquid liner over the substrate to create a moisture barrier. This step is critical in preventing water from seeping into the subfloor.
Attach the Drain Grate or Cover: Once the floor is set and cured, secure the drain grate. Choose a design that allows easy removal for cleaning. Grates with small holes or intricate patterns can trap debris and increase the risk of clogs, so consider the balance between style and function.
Preventing Clogs and Odors
Even with a perfectly installed drain, maintenance plays a key role in preventing issues. Some practical tips include:
Use Drain Strainers: Installing a simple strainer over the drain captures hair, soap scum, and other debris before it enters the pipe. This is the single most effective step in avoiding clogs.
Regular Cleaning: Remove the drain cover periodically and clean the trap beneath. Warm water mixed with mild detergent can dissolve accumulated residue. For stubborn buildup, a soft brush or pipe snake can help.
Avoid Harsh Chemicals: While chemical drain cleaners may seem convenient, they can erode pipes over time, especially PVC. Opt for enzyme-based or natural cleaning solutions instead.
Maintain Water Flow: Occasionally, flush the drain with hot water to clear small blockages and maintain smooth flow.
Odors often originate from a dry or improperly vented drain. Ensure the drain trap is always filled with water, as it serves as a barrier against sewer gases. For rarely used showers, pour water into the drain regularly to prevent the trap from drying out.
Preventing Water Damage
Water damage is one of the most serious consequences of improper drain installation. To safeguard your home:
Seal Joints and Edges: Use high-quality silicone sealant around the perimeter of the shower pan and drain flange.
Inspect Subflooring: Before installing the shower floor, check for rot, mold, or soft spots. Replace damaged sections to prevent leaks.
Check Waterproofing: Liquid membranes or sheet membranes should cover the entire shower floor and walls to contain moisture. Make sure seams and corners are carefully sealed.
Slope Properly: A consistent slope toward the drain ensures water doesn’t accumulate on the floor. Even minor deviations can cause puddles and long-term damage.
Advanced Tips for Longevity
For homeowners seeking extra reliability, consider these advanced measures:
Ventilation: Proper bathroom ventilation reduces humidity, minimizing the risk of mold near the drain area.
Backwater Valves: In areas prone to heavy rainfall or sewer backups, a backwater valve prevents reverse flow that can overwhelm the shower drain.
Professional Inspection: For complex plumbing systems, hiring a licensed plumber to inspect your installation ensures compliance with local codes and prevents unseen issues.
